The common-or-garden T-shirt, as soon as considered a simple undergarment, has undergone a remarkable transformation over the years. From its inception as a primary piece of clothing to its present standing as a coveted fashion item, the designer T-shirt has evolved significantly. In this article, we will discover the fascinating journey of designer T-shirts, from their origins as wardrobe staples to changing into statement items that mirror personal style and societal trends.  
  
The Birth of the T-Shirt  
  
The T-shirt's journey started in the early 20th century when it was launched as an undergarment for the United States Navy. Its name originated from its shape, resembling the letter "T" when laid flat. Initially, T-shirts had been plain, white, and devoid of any embellishments, designed purely for functionality and comfort. They had been made from lightweight cotton fabric, making them ideally suited for the military and workwear.  
  
The 1950s - A Cultural Shift  
  
The Nineteen Fifties marked a turning level for the T-shirt. It transitioned from being an undergarment to an emblem of revolt and youthful expression. Marlon Brando's iconic portrayal of a motorcycle gang leader in "The Wild One" showcased the T-shirt as a symbol of non-conformity. James Dean's rebellious image in "Insurgent Without a Cause" further popularized this trend.  
  
Rock 'n' Roll and Pop Tradition  
  
The Sixties and Nineteen Seventies noticed the T-shirt firmly establish itself in widespread culture. Bands like The Beatles and The Rolling Stones began incorporating T-shirts with band logos into their merchandise, creating a connection between music and fashion. This period additionally witnessed the rise of tie-dye T-shirts, mirroring the counterculture movement and the hunt for individuality.  
  
Designer T-Shirts Take Center Stage  
  
The Nineteen Eighties marked the emergence of designer T-shirts as luxury fashion items. Designers like Giorgio Armani, Calvin Klein, and Ralph Lauren introduced high-end T-shirts that featured premium fabrics and subtle branding. The traditional white T-shirt became a staple of upscale wardrobes, symbolizing informal elegance.  
  
Logomania and Branding  
  
The Nineties ushered within the period of "logomania," where designer logos have been prominently displayed on clothing, together with T-shirts. Brands like Versace, Gucci, and Chanel capitalized on this development, turning T-shirts into standing symbols. These shirts often featured elaborate prints, embroidery, and embellishments, elevating them from basics to statement pieces.  
  
The Streetwear Revolution  
  
Within the early 2000s, streetwear emerged as a powerful force in fashion, revolutionizing the designer T-shirt landscape. Brands like Supreme, Bape, and Off-White disrupted the traditional luxury fashion scene by embracing bold graphics, limited releases, and collaborations with artists and musicians. The designer T-shirt grew to become a canvas for artistic expression, with streetwear fans accumulating them like art pieces.  
  
The Sustainability Movement  
  
As awareness of environmental issues grew in the fashion business, designers began to prioritize sustainability in their T-shirt production. Eco-friendly materials and ethical manufacturing processes gained prominence. Consumers started gravitating towards maintainable designer T-shirts, reflecting a shift towards aware consumption and responsible fashion.  
  
Personal Expression and Individuality  
  
Today, designer T-shirts have evolved into a method of personal expression. They permit individuals to convey their beliefs, passions, and affiliations by graphic designs and slogans. Customizable T-shirts have become common, enabling people to create unique items that reflect their identity.  
  
Conclusion  
  
The evolution of designer T-shirts from fundamental undergarments to statement pieces mirrors the ever-changing landscape of fashion and culture. These garments have transcended their utilitarian origins, turning into symbols of rebel, standing, artwork, and personal identity. As we look to the longer term, it's clear that designer T-shirts will continue to evolve, reflecting the values and aspirations of every generation and serving as a canvas for artistic expression on the planet of fashion.
